HP Officejet 6310


$150.00 Released August, 2008

Product Shot 1 The Pros:Affordable price. Ethernet connectivity - usable on a computer network without the need for an online PC host. Multi-function - print, scan, copy and fax.

The Cons:Uses a lot of ink. No wireless capabilities. Software is poor and very large.

The HP Officejet 6310 is an all in one print, fax, copier developed so that it could be sold at a low cost. The printer comes with Ethernet and USB capabilities making it flexible; it can be hooked up to a network and printed to from multiple computers, or connected to just one.

The HP Officejet 6310 in its fast draft setting can print up to 30 pages per minute in solid black and can do up to 24 pages per minute in color. The copier portion of the Officejet has digital image processing, digital zoom, fit to page, pre-scan, and can handle up to one hundred copies of the original.

Features

  • Print, fax, copier
  • Ethernet connection
  • USB connection
  • Integrated Optical Character Recognition software
  • TWAIN compliant interface
  • 8.5 x 11.7" maximum scan size from the glass
  • 33.6 Kbps fax transmission speed
  • 110 speed dials
  • Up to 120 page memory
